<title>ppc: Fix roll over bug in flush_cache()</title>

If we call flush_cache(0xfffff000, 0x1000) it would never
terminate the loop since end = 0xffffffff and we'd roll over
our counter from 0xfffffe0 to 0 (assuming a 32-byte cache line)

Some boards (e.g. lwmon5) need rather a frequent watch-dog
kicking. Since the time it takes for the flush_cache() function
to complete its job depends on the size of data being flushed, one
may encounter watch-dog resets on such boards when, for example,
download big files over ethernet.
